Two fixed frictionless inclined plane making an angle $30^{\circ}$ and $60^{\circ}$ with the vertical are shown in the figure. Two block $A$ and $B$ are placed on the two planes. What is the relative vertical acceleration of $A$ with respect to $B$ ?
$4.9 \mathrm{~ms}^{-2}$ in horizontal direction
$9.8 \mathrm{~ms}^{-2}$ in vertical direction
zero
$4.9 \mathrm{~ms}^{-2}$ in vertical direction
Solution
$m g \sin \theta=m a$
$\therefore \quad a=g \sin \theta$
where $\mathrm{a}$ is along the inclined plane
$\therefore \quad$ vertical component of acceleration is $\mathrm{g} \sin ^2 \theta$
$\therefore \quad$ relative vertical acceleration of $A$ with respect to $B$ is
